How do encryption protocols safeguard player data in top online casinos?

Role of SSL/TLS certificates in protecting sensitive information

Secure Sockets Layer (SSL) and Transport Layer Security (TLS) are foundational to encrypting data exchanged between players and casino servers. These protocols create a secure channel that prevents eavesdropping and data tampering. Leading online casinos employ Extended Validation (EV) SSL certificates issued by trusted authorities, which activate browser indicators such as green address bars, reinforcing player confidence. According to a 2022 report by Cybersecurity Ventures, over 90% of online security breaches involve data interception, underscoring the necessity of SSL/TLS in protecting personal and financial data.

Implementation challenges and best practices for encryption

Implementing robust encryption involves managing key exchange processes, maintaining up-to-date protocols, and preventing vulnerabilities like cipher suite downgrades. Best practices include deploying TLS 1.3, enabling Perfect Forward Secrecy (PFS), and performing regular security audits. For example, a comprehensive audit by XYZ Security in 2021 revealed that outdated SSL configurations exposed some platforms to man-in-the-middle attacks. Top casinos mitigate such risks by automating updates and leveraging Content Delivery Networks (CDNs) that enforce encryption standards across their infrastructure.

What authentication mechanisms ensure user identity verification?

Use of multi-factor authentication in high-revenue platforms

Multi-factor authentication (MFA) combines something a user knows (password), something they have (security token), and something they are (biometrics). Leading online casinos like Betway or 888casino utilize MFA during login and fund transfer processes, significantly reducing the risk of account breaches. Studies suggest that MFA reduces account takeovers by over 99%, contributing directly to enhanced trust and security, especially in high-stakes gambling environments.

Biometric verification and its integration into casino login processes

Biometric verification methods—such as fingerprint scans, facial recognition, and voice authentication—are increasingly integrated into online casino apps. For example, some platforms incorporate biometric login via mobile devices, leveraging device sensors for quick, secure access. This approach not only boosts security but also improves user experience by offering seamless, fraud-resistant verification. A study by CyberSecure Labs found that biometric methods can prevent over 95% of identity fraud attempts, making them a valuable tool in high-profit casinos.

Evaluating the effectiveness of identity verification services

Third-party identity verification platforms, like Jumio or Onfido, provide real-time document authentication and biometric matching. Their effectiveness hinges on comprehensive databases, document authenticity checks, and liveness detection. For instance, after integrating Jumio, CasinoXYZ reported a 70% reduction in identity fraud incidents. Regular audits and adaptive verification thresholds help optimize effectiveness while minimizing false positives—ensuring both security and customer satisfaction.

How do licensing and regulatory compliance enhance security standards?

Impact of jurisdiction-specific licensing on security protocols

Licensing authorities such as the UK Gambling Commission, Malta Gaming Authority, and Gibraltar Regulatory Authority impose strict security requirements, including encryption standards, KYC procedures, and regular audits. Casinos regulated under these jurisdictions must adhere to evolving security protocols; for example, the UKGC mandates Data Protection Impact Assessments (DPIAs) and incident reporting, which strengthen security frameworks. Such licensing acts as a seal of compliance that reassures players that their data and funds are protected according to high standards.

Mandatory security audits mandated by gaming authorities

Periodic independent audits verify compliance with security standards. For example, in 2020, a Malta-licensed casino underwent a comprehensive security audit, revealing vulnerabilities that were promptly remediated. Ongoing audits ensure that casinos maintain compliance, identify emerging risks, and adapt to technological changes—ultimately reinforcing their security posture and avoiding hefty penalties or license revocation.

Consequences of non-compliance for security and reputation

Non-compliance can lead to fines, suspension of operations, and damage to brand reputation. For instance, a high-profile case involved a casino losing its license after a security breach was reported without prompt action, costing millions in revenue and eroding customer trust. This underscores the importance of adhering to regulatory security requirements as integral to a profitable and sustainable online casino operation.

What advanced fraud detection techniques are employed by top casinos?

Real-time monitoring and anomaly detection systems

Top casinos deploy sophisticated anti-fraud platforms like Forter or Kount that analyze transactions and user behaviors in real time. These systems identify anomalies such as unusual betting patterns or rapid account access attempts. For example, a live monitoring system detected suspicious activity on a casino platform, preventing a multi-million dollar fraud scheme. The ability to act instantly minimizes losses and protects both the casino and players.

Machine learning algorithms for identifying suspicious activities

Machine learning models analyze historical data and behavioral patterns to predict and flag potentially fraudulent activities. For example, in 2022, a major online casino integrated ML algorithms that reduced false positives by 30%, enabling faster verification of genuine players. These models continuously learn and adapt, enhancing detection accuracy and reducing operational friction.

How do secure payment processing systems protect financial transactions?

Integration of third-party payment gateways with robust security measures

Leading casinos partner with providers like Trustly, PayPal, and Stripe that enforce compliance with PCI DSS standards, ensuring secure handling of card and banking data. These gateways employ SSL/TLS, end-to-end encryption, and fraud detection checks. For example, Stripe’s platform uses machine learning to identify and block suspicious transactions, reducing fraudulent activity by up to 85%.

Use of tokenization and secure escrow methods

Tokenization replaces sensitive payment data with randomly generated tokens, rendering stolen data useless for fraudsters. Secure escrow arrangements hold funds until game outcome confirmation, reducing chargeback risks. For instance, some casinos implement escrow mechanisms in high-stakes betting, ensuring both the player and casino are protected from fraud-related losses.

Mitigating chargeback and refund fraud risks

Automated fraud detection systems scrutinize refund requests and chargeback patterns, flagging suspicious cases quickly. Additionally, transparent transaction histories and verification steps prevent false claims. Casinos that adopt these methods report a 60-70% reduction in fraud-related chargebacks, preserving profitability and maintaining secure financial operations.

What role does responsible data management play in security architecture?

Data minimization and encryption of stored player information

By limiting data collection to essential information and encrypting stored data, casinos reduce exposure to data breaches. For example, protocols like AES-256 encryption and strict data access policies are standard practices. A 2021 survey showed that data breaches involving inadequately encrypted data resulted in average losses of over $3 million, reiterating the importance of vigilant data management.

Access controls and audit trails for sensitive data

Strict role-based access controls limit data handling to authorized personnel, while comprehensive audit logs monitor all data access and modifications. This traceability enhances accountability and facilitates rapid incident response. For example, implementing multi-layered access controls prevented internal data leaks in several major online gambling companies, saving millions in potential damages. Impact of data breaches on trust and profitability

Data breaches erode customer confidence, leading to increased churn and regulatory penalties. Studies indicate that a single breach can reduce a company’s revenue by as much as 20%, emphasizing that secure data management isn’t just compliance—it directly influences profitability and long-term success.

How are emerging technologies shaping security practices in profitable online casinos?

Blockchain applications for transparency and security

Blockchain offers immutable, transparent records that enhance game fairness and prevent tampering. Casinos like FunFair and barrels of others incorporate blockchain for provably fair gaming and secure transaction tracking. This technology reduces fraud risk and increases player trust, evident from a 2023 survey where 76% of players preferred casinos employing blockchain verification.

Artificial intelligence in predictive security analysis

AI analytics predict emerging threats by analyzing vast datasets for unusual patterns. For example, casinos using AI-based security systems like ThreatMetrix identified zero-day fraud tactics before they caused damage, reducing threat levels by 40%. This proactive approach enhances security resilience and supports profitability by minimizing losses.

Potential vulnerabilities of new tech integrations and mitigation strategies

Emerging technologies also introduce new risks, such as smart contract bugs in blockchain or adversarial attacks on AI. To mitigate these, casinos conduct security audits, implement redundancy layers, and continuously update their systems. A proactive stance ensures that technological advancements bolster rather than compromise security integrity in high-value online casinos.
